How Diyan Reduced Video Production Time by 80% with Animaker?

Diyan
Educator and researcher working in UK higher education

This case study shows how Diyan, an academic and researcher, used Animaker to transform her research and educational ideas into engaging animated stories.

She uses animation to communicate her research on inclusive reading lists and to develop engaging teaching and learning materials.

Although she had no prior animation experience, using Animaker, she was able to cut her video production time by about 70 to 80%. The content got great results, extending the reach of her research beyond the usual face-to-face classroom distribution.

Now, let's hear from Diyan about how she found success communicating her ideas to the masses through visual stories.

The Challenge

Just as many researchers and educators do, I wished to go beyond conventional research papers and presentations and to find more engaging methods of communicating important ideas.

I needed a solution that was affordable and didn't take weeks to produce.

The aim was to turn difficult ideas into simple and easy-to-remember stories which people could understand, remember and pass on.

Why Animation?

Animation seemed to be the ideal medium since it brings together storytelling, visuals, and sound in order to make complicated ideas more interesting.

I wanted to present my research in a medium that would be understandable and interesting to both an academic and a general public audience. I felt Animation was the right format that would help me express the information in a more accessible and engaging form.

Bringing Research to Life

Here’s the first animation that I made using Animaker as a newbie.

As a researcher, I wanted to find a new and interesting format to present my research on inclusive reading lists, and this is how the story One Awesome Reading List That Changed My Mindset came about.

The animation was distributed at institutional learning and teaching events and at external conferences, so that it could be seen by university colleagues and other professional audiences. 

In the next three years, the feedback given by the viewers was positive and very encouraging.
